Bug description:
  There is a new upstream release of tzdata, 2020, which includes the
  following:

    * New upstream release, affecting past and future timestamps:
      - Morocco springs forward on 2020-05-31, not 2020-05-24.
      - Canada's Yukon advanced to -07 year-round on 2020-03-08.
      - America/Nuuk renamed from America/Godthab.

  Verification is done with 'zdump'. The first timezone that gets
  changed in the updated package is dumped with "zdump -v
  $region/$timezone_that_changed" (this needed to be greped for in
  /usr/share/zoneinfo/). [For example: "zdump -v Africa/Casablanca".]
  This is compared to the same output after the updated package got
  installed. If those are different the verification is considered done.
